Beginner-Friendly Mountain Hikes:

1. The Dolomites, Italy:

Dolomites Hike

The Dolomites offer a stunning variety of relatively easy hikes, perfect for beginners. Paths wind through lush valleys, past emerald lakes, and alongside towering peaks. The well-maintained trails and numerous mountain huts make for a comfortable and enjoyable experience. Consider the Seceda trail or the Alpe di Siusi for breathtaking panoramic views.

2. Mount Fuji, Japan:

Mount Fuji Hike

While the climb to the summit of Mount Fuji can be strenuous, the Yoshida Trail, the most popular route, is accessible to hikers with moderate fitness levels. The well-defined path and numerous rest stops make the ascent manageable. Witnessing the sunrise from the summit is an unforgettable experience.

3. Table Mountain, South Africa:

Table Mountain Hike

Table Mountain offers various hiking trails, from gentle walks to more challenging climbs. The Platteklip Gorge is a popular choice, offering a steep but rewarding ascent to the summit. Enjoy unparalleled views of Cape Town and the surrounding coastline.

Intermediate Mountain Hikes:

4. The Inca Trail, Peru:

Inca Trail Trek

This iconic trek to Machu Picchu is a bucket-list adventure for many. The trail requires moderate fitness and takes 4 days to complete. Hikers are rewarded with stunning views of the Andes Mountains, ancient Inca ruins, and the breathtaking Machu Picchu itself. Note: permits are required and must be booked well in advance.

5. Torres del Paine, Chile:

Torres del Paine Hike

Torres del Paine National Park offers a range of multi-day treks, including the famous 'W' trek, known for its diverse landscapes. The challenging terrain and unpredictable weather require proper preparation, but the stunning granite peaks, glaciers, and turquoise lakes make it an unforgettable journey.

Advanced Mountain Hikes:

6. Kilimanjaro, Tanzania:

Kilimanjaro Hike

Scaling Africa's highest peak is a significant undertaking, requiring excellent physical fitness, acclimatization, and experienced guides. Several routes exist, each with its unique challenges and rewards. Reaching the summit is a life-changing achievement.

7. Annapurna Circuit, Nepal:

Annapurna Circuit Trek

This challenging trek takes hikers through diverse landscapes, from lush rhododendron forests to high-altitude passes and barren moonscapes. The Annapurna Circuit requires excellent physical fitness, proper preparation, and a good level of experience. It offers unparalleled views of the Annapurna and Dhaulagiri mountain ranges.

Planning Your Mountain Hike:

Before embarking on any mountain hike, careful planning is crucial. Consider the following:

  • Fitness level: Choose a trail appropriate for your experience and physical abilities.
  • Weather conditions: Be prepared for unpredictable weather, particularly at higher altitudes.
  • Equipment: Pack appropriate clothing, footwear, and gear.
  • Permits and regulations: Research and obtain necessary permits and follow trail regulations.
  • Guides and support: Consider hiring a guide, particularly for challenging treks.
